Ice sculpture

I was adding some feed to bird feeder, when I noticed this piece of ice below the table on my balcony. I snapped an image with an iPhone, and run some filters in Best Camera (you can check out the recipe here). Are you seeing any animal in that? I saw a fish with its mouth up, or a small critter sitting on its back with paws up.